About the program and position
The European Graduate Program is designed to attract and develop newly graduated talent to ensure SSAB’s future critical competencies. Over the course of 14 months, you will be engaged in a series of workshops and lectures that provides in-depth knowledge of SSAB’s operations, leadership practices, and a wide network of professional contacts.
The program includes visits to SSAB’s production sites in Finland and Sweden, as well as an individual trip to a business location of particular interest. Throughout the program, you are paired with a senior mentor who provides personalized guidance and support. The program concludes with a final presentation to SSAB’s management team, where you will present your learnings and experiences.
In the role as Process Engineer, you will hold a key position in fulfilling the company’s strategy related to process and quality development by contributing to a more digitally driven production. You will lead and implement improvement initiatives and new ways of working using digital tools. The role offers a broad local network in Borlänge as well as across other production sites, primarily Luleå. Travel between locations may occur.
As part of the transition toward fossil-free steel production, construction of a new facility in Luleå is currently ongoing. Therefore, the Process Engineer role will initially start in Borlänge, where you will work closely with existing process developers within the Cold Rolling department. You will gain knowledge and experience in Borlänge and later take on a central role in the startup of the new facility in Luleå by training colleagues and transferring the expertise gained during your time in Borlänge
